Transaction 59e255454455e549eb7f43880270fc36015ea7e3ec994b372d64394829793369

1 Input
2 Outputs
  • 59e255454455e549eb7f43880270fc36015ea7e3ec994b372d64394829793369:0
  • value  624727
    address  1CFgJEc6XeuajcCXM2B42BG4waEY7AjQzc
  • 59e255454455e549eb7f43880270fc36015ea7e3ec994b372d64394829793369:1
  • value  4535538
    address  1FgVz2x4tFTjGz2Ywqn8jXG2Nmhtvv7n6F